Transaction 70967b73bb270bfe58cffb34a5482857b4526c168e8495dd4cbea0e4cfed2c52
1 Input
2 Outputs
- 70967b73bb270bfe58cffb34a5482857b4526c168e8495dd4cbea0e4cfed2c52:0
- 70967b73bb270bfe58cffb34a5482857b4526c168e8495dd4cbea0e4cfed2c52:1
value 50023
address 13qtNbjaCmwQyxs8etTQJGmAYkoqD71X9v
value 55467
address 35XUvLfDM81bYG8PDHXp1Aw34HFFHu5jto